Dell SupportAssist is a system management application created to assist Dell users with device maintenance. It automatically checks your system for potential issues and provides guidance on resolving them. The tool can identify hardware concerns, performance slowdowns, and update related matters before they cause serious problems.
Once installed, it becomes a central place where you can view your device status and take action when needed.

Before starting the installation process, it is a good idea to check whether Dell SupportAssist is already available on your device. Many Dell systems come with it preinstalled.
You can check by:
Searching for the application name in your system search
Looking through the installed applications list
Checking the Dell folder on your device
If you find it already installed, you may only need to open it and complete initial setup steps.

Sometimes, installation may not complete as expected. This can happen due to system conflicts or temporary issues.
If installation fails, try the following:
Restart your device
Close background applications
Ensure your internet connection is stable
Attempt installation again
These steps often resolve common installation problems.
